This paper is concerned with the back and forth nudging algorithm for data assimilationn, a set of techniques that combine the mathematical information provided by the model with the physical information given by observations, in order to retrieve the state of the system. The study is carried over on various type of equations such as viscous transport equation, Burgers' equation etc. The main results of the paper establish the convergence of the algorithm which is all cases of differential equations considered is exponential in time.
